Chicago Loop, Chicago, IL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chicago Loop?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Chicago Loop Studio Apartments | $2,589 | $1,224 | $7,094 |
Chicago Loop 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,041 | $1,234 | $9,999 |
| Chicago Loop 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,557 | $1,819 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ago Loop 3 Bedroom Apartments | $7,846 | $1,024 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ago Loop 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,937 | $1,025 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Chicago Loop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Chicago Loop with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Chicago Loop is at 731 Plymouth by 3L Living listed at $1,929.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Chicago Loop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Chicago Loop is $3,041.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Chicago Loop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Chicago Loop is a 1,234 square feet unit starting from $3,210 at Lofts At River East.
What is the average size for Chicago Loop 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Chicago Loop is currently 767 sq ft.
